Transaction f31d56fb8feda31dbfef97221cb6ca5e2e1bb1040b5f0273e46c6ca708018609

1 Input
2 Outputs
  • f31d56fb8feda31dbfef97221cb6ca5e2e1bb1040b5f0273e46c6ca708018609:0
  • value  31935490
    address  1M38pviQJdNhGnxNZzAjuyVY6PGp3uzQqZ
  • f31d56fb8feda31dbfef97221cb6ca5e2e1bb1040b5f0273e46c6ca708018609:1
  • value  40000000
    address  34mRv3fTG6AjgeMXVgbq1v72WUzLdjLHcA